Global Soil Moisture Sensor Market size will grow at a 14% CAGR from 2024 to 2032 due to the adoption of precision agriculture techniques and innovation in sensor technology. With the increasing global population and diminishing arable land, there's a pressing need for efficient water management solutions. Soil moisture sensors are crucial in optimizing irrigation practices and enhancing crop yields. Moreover, advancements in sensor technology, including wireless connectivity and multi-depth sensors, offer farmers real-time and accurate soil moisture data, aligning with the trend toward precision agriculture.

For instance, in October 2022, Soil Scout unveiled the Dual Depth Sensor (DDS), expanding its Hydra sensor with an extra sensing head connected via cable, enhancing soil moisture monitoring capabilities. This innovation could stimulate growth in the soil moisture sensor industry by offering enhanced capabilities for accurate and comprehensive soil moisture monitoring, thereby meeting the increasing demand for precision agriculture solutions.

The soil moisture sensor market is fragmented based on product, type, connectivity, application, and region.

The volumetric segment will experience a remarkable upswing by 2032. Volumetric soil moisture sensors offer accurate measurements by directly quantifying the volume of water in the soil. This method provides valuable insights into soil moisture levels crucial for optimizing irrigation practices and maximizing crop yield. Additionally, advancements in sensor technology, such as wireless connectivity and remote monitoring capabilities, further enhance the appeal and adoption of volumetric soil moisture sensors in agriculture and environmental monitoring applications.

The agriculture segment will achieve a considerable foothold through 2032. With the global population soaring and arable land diminishing, there's a pressing need to optimize agricultural productivity. Soil moisture sensors play a crucial role in enabling farmers to monitor and manage water usage efficiently, thus enhancing crop yields and conserving resources. Furthermore, the growing acceptance of precision farming methods amplifies the requirement for soil moisture sensors within the agricultural segment, reinforcing its prominence within the market.

Asia Pacific soil moisture sensor industry share will exhibit a noteworthy CAGR during 2024 and 2032, driven by the region's vast agricultural sector coupled with increasing adoption of precision agriculture techniques. Additionally, government initiatives promoting sustainable farming practices and water conservation further stimulate market growth. Rapid urbanization and industrialization also fuel the need for efficient water management solutions in the region. With a growing emphasis on environmental sustainability, Asia Pacific will emerge as a pivotal contributor to the soil moisture sensor market.
